In an emotional and unfiltered moment that has captivated the wrestling world, former WWE prospect Jin Tala has broken her silence following her sudden and unexpected release — and her words have struck a powerful chord with fans around the globe.

Just days after her name appeared among the latest round of WWE talent cuts, the young performer took to social media late last night to share what many are calling one of the most heartfelt messages ever written by a released superstar.

“Maybe I was just another unrecognizable name on a list,” she began, her tone both vulnerable and defiant. “Or maybe they just couldn’t see what I see in myself.”

It was a single paragraph — short, aching, and honest — but in those words, Jin Tala managed to capture the universal pain of being overlooked, the heartbreak of unfulfilled dreams, and the flickering flame of self-belief that refuses to die. Within minutes, her message went viral, echoing across fan forums, wrestling news outlets, and social media timelines.

Inside the WWE Reaction

Behind the scenes, sources describe Jin’s release as part of a larger restructuring effort within WWE’s developmental division. Yet even among those accustomed to such shakeups, her name reportedly caused surprise.

“She was well-liked,” one WWE staffer said. “She worked hard, never complained, always asked questions. Everyone thought she’d get her shot eventually. This one stings.”

Another insider suggested that Jin had been scheduled for more TV appearances later this year before plans were abruptly shifted. “It happens all the time,” the source admitted. “Creative changes, roster adjustments — sometimes the timing just isn’t right. But in Jin’s case, it feels like a missed opportunity.”

Indeed, many within the wrestling community believe her release says less about her ability and more about the unpredictable nature of the business. WWE’s history is full of names once deemed “expendable” who later became icons elsewhere — from Drew McIntyre and Cody Rhodes to Emma and Taya Valkyrie.

“If history tells us anything,” tweeted one wrestling journalist, “it’s that this could be the start of something huge for Jin Tala. The stars who rise from rejection are often the ones who define the next era.”
